Spider Mites on Amla: Causes, Checks & Fixes

Quick answer

Spider mites on Amla (Phyllanthus emblica, Indian gooseberry) almost always show up as pale stippling and fine silk webbing on the feathery compound leaves at branchlet tips—the tiny leaflets that look soft and fresh during warm-season flush. Unlike broad-leaved houseplants, the damage is easy to miss from across a terrace until individual leaflets turn yellowish or bronze and fine webbing appears between the narrow blades.

For how spider mites reproduce, why dry air favors them, and when water knockdown works in general, see our spider mites pest guide. On Amla, the practical pattern is post-monsoon dry heat on sunny terraces (September–October), stippling concentrated on the newest feathery flush, and extra confusion because feathery foliage hides colonies until you magnify leaflet undersides or shake a cluster over white paper.

First step: isolate the pot from other fruit trees if needed, then rinse the undersides of the newest feathery branchlet clusters with a strong lukewarm stream—covering every leaflet axis—before reaching for oils or miticides.

What spider mites look like on Amla

Spider mites are tiny arachnids, not insects—adult females are less than 1/20 inch long that live in colonies on leaf undersides. On Amla they colonize the narrow leaflets within feathery branchlet clusters, where silk webbing is harder to spot than on a single large leaf blade.

Healthy Amla branchlets carry fine feathery compound leaves along slender woody stems in full sun. A few pale dots on one sunny side during a dry week are common on vigorous terrace trees—worry when stippling spreads branchlet to branchlet within days.

Where mites hide on feathery branchlet foliage

Amla’s feathery leaves are not one blade—they are dozens of tiny linear leaflets along each branchlet axis. Spider mites tuck into the junctions where leaflets meet the rachis and along the midrib on undersides. From across a terrace you see a slightly dull branchlet tip; only when you fold a cluster back do the stippling and silk threads become obvious.

This growth form matters for treatment. A quick overhead mist misses the undersides of half the leaflets. You need to aim the rinse along each feathery axis and work branchlet by branchlet on container trees. On larger terrace specimens, prioritize the sunniest quarter of the canopy where dry conditions favor outbreaks.

Post-monsoon terrace dry spells

Amla is a subtropical fruit tree that prefers dry climate and tolerates drought once established—but that same terrace culture creates mite weather. After monsoon rains end, September and October often bring hot reflected wall heat, fast-drying pots, and low humidity beside sunny railings. Mites that were barely visible during humid monsoon growth can explode on soft new branchlet flush.

If stippling appears right after you eased off watering in cool evenings, cross-check underwatering—but when webbing is present and the pot is not bone-dry, treat mites first. Chronic drought alone rarely produces silk between leaflets.

Why Amla gets spider mites

Hot dry micro-climates on terraces. Dry weather greatly favors spider mites because lower humidity helps them shed excess water, while many predators need more humid conditions. Amla pots beside south-facing walls, concrete, or metal railings bake faster than the ambient forecast suggests.

Drought-stressed foliage. Plants stressed by drought can become more nutritious to mites. Skipping deep soaks during a heat wave while the top 3–5 cm dries out leaves feathery tips vulnerable—pair mite treatment with corrected watering rhythm, not extra fertilizer.

Dusty feathery leaves. Terrace wind coats fine leaflets with dust that interferes with predatory mites. A periodic rinse during dry months helps prevention as much as crisis treatment.

Broad-spectrum insecticides. Sprays aimed at aphids or caterpillars can wipe out lady beetles, predatory mites, and other allies—setting up mite rebounds on the next warm dry spell.

How to confirm the cause

Work through these checks in order before spraying oils on a sunny afternoon:

  1. White-paper shake test — Snip or hold a stippled feathery cluster over white paper and tap firmly. Mites move rapidly when disturbed; if nothing moves, reconsider thrips or old sun scorch.
  2. Webbing location — Fine silk between leaflets points to mites. Loose bark webbing with wood dust at the stem base suggests caterpillar galleries, not foliar mites.
  3. Sticky vs dry damage — Glossy honeydew on shoot tips means aphids, not mites.
  4. Internal tunnelsSerpentine pale trails inside a leaflet mean leaf miners, not surface stippling.
  5. Pot weight and soil depth — A light pot with crispy margins everywhere may be drought; stippling with webbing on a moderately moist pot points to mites in dry air.

The first fix to try

Rinse branchlet undersides with a strong lukewarm stream, working feathery clusters one at a time until water runs clean from every leaflet axis. Forceful spraying often reduces mite numbers adequately on garden and small fruit trees when you get thorough coverage.

Do this in early morning or late evening—not in midday sun on a heat-stressed terrace tree. Let foliage dry before nightfall to avoid fungal issues on dense feathery tips.

Re-inspect with the shake test in three days. If mites persist and stippling spreads, move to step two—not a bundled spray stack on day one.

Recovery timeline

Mild stippling on one branchlet often stabilizes within one to two weeks after two thorough rinses and corrected watering. Feathery leaflets that already bronzed stay marked—judge recovery by clean new branchlet tips on the next flush, not by older speckled blades.

Severe webbing across the canopy may need three to four weeks and two careful soap or oil cycles spaced seven to ten days apart. Flower buds that shriveled during heavy feeding rarely reflower on the same branchlet; wait for the next seasonal flush.

Mistakes to avoid

Do not blast feathery foliage with cold water at noon on a baking terrace—leaflet scorch can mimic mite damage.

Do not apply horticultural oil when the tree is wilting or soil is bone-dry. Fix watering first.

Do not confuse bark caterpillar webbing with foliar mite silk—stem galleries need caterpillar handling, not repeated leaf rinses.

Do not fertilize during an active infestation. Soft nitrogen-rich shoots feed the next mite generation.

Do not assume one rinse is enough. Mite eggs in webbing hatch on a staggered schedule—follow-up scouting matters more than the first knockdown.

How to prevent spider mites next time

Scout new branchlet flush weekly from September through October when terrace air turns hot and dry after monsoon.

Keep Amla in full sun with airy sandy loam mix and deep soaks when the top 3–5 cm dries—avoid chronic drought stress on young grafts.

Rinse dusty feathery leaves after long dry spells; periodic hosing removes mites and dust that blocks predators.

Preserve beneficial insects when possible. Skip broad-spectrum sprays for minor aphid colonies if predators are already working.

If you overwinter a container tree indoors, pull it away from heating vents and inspect feathery tips weekly—indoor dry air overlaps with low humidity stress and mite flare-ups.

When to worry

Small stippling on one sunny branchlet during a dry week is common on established terrace Amla and rarely threatens a firm tree if you rinse early. Escalate when dense webbing coats multiple tips, stippling spreads branchlet to branchlet within days, or flower buds fail across the canopy during post-monsoon heat.

Act urgently if branchlets wilt, lower leaves yellow in waves, and mix stays wet for weeks—switch to root rot or wilting diagnosis rather than repeating foliar sprays alone.

Frequently asked questions

How can I confirm spider mites on Amla?

Look for pale yellow or bronze stippling on individual tiny leaflets within feathery branchlet clusters, plus fine silk webbing between leaflets—not sticky honeydew like aphids or cottony tufts like mealybugs. Tap a damaged cluster over white paper; mites appear as moving dust specks. A 10X hand lens on leaflet undersides should show colonies and eggs along the midrib.

What should I check first for spider mites on Amla?

Start at the softest new branchlet tips where feathery leaves are still expanding, especially on the sunny side of a terrace pot or beside a reflected wall. Lower mature canopy can look clean while the top flush shows stippling. Check whether the pot dried out fast in recent heat and whether fine webbing appears only on new growth—not bark galleries from caterpillars.

Will damaged Amla leaves recover from spider mites?

Stippled or bronzed leaflets rarely return to perfect green because Amla branchlets harden slowly. Recovery means mites stop spreading and the next one or two flushes open with clean feathery foliage. Judge success by firm new branchlet tips, not by older speckled leaflets lower on the stem.

When are spider mites urgent on Amla?

Act quickly when dense webbing coats multiple branchlet tips, stippling spreads through the whole canopy in a week, or flower buds shrivel during dry post-monsoon heat. A few pale dots on one sunny branchlet beside clean neighbors is common on terrace trees and usually responds to early rinsing without insecticides.

How do I prevent spider mites on Amla next time?

Scout new branchlet flush weekly from September through October when terrace air turns hot and dry. Keep the tree in full sun with steady deep watering when the top 3–5 cm of mix dries—drought-stressed foliage is more vulnerable. Avoid broad-spectrum insecticides that kill predatory mites, and rinse dusty feathery leaves after long dry spells.
